Dedup defaults changed in MergeKit 4.2. Fuzzy matching now runs on name+postal fields by default; exact-email-only matching is opt-in. Merge candidates below 0.85 confidence go to the review queue instead of auto-merging. Survivorship now prefers most-recently-verified record, not oldest. Nightly dedup batch window moved to 02:00 Varnholt time to avoid the billing export. Impact: expect a one-time spike in review-queue volume this week. Rollback flag remains available until 4.3. The new defaults shipped to all regions are as follows.

settings of kagag-kagef:
[kelath]
port = 9300
region = west-4
host = kelath.olvarqworks.example
team = sorion
timeout_ms = 1000
retries = 8

**Changed defaults — ORM refactor (week 31)**

Heads up for the sync: as part of gutting the old Tanglewire ORM layer, we flipped a few defaults. Lazy loading is now off, statement timeouts are enforced, and the connection pool shrank to something sane. Most call sites won't notice; batch jobs might. New services should start from these defaults.

service settings:
[casax]
port = 6379
team = rusir
host = casax.zemvarhq.corp
region = outer-4
access_code = ac_9808ce
timeout_ms = 1500

## TICKET-4471: Vault locked during Lattermill N+1 fix deploy

While shipping the batching fix for the Quarrel GraphQL resolvers, the deploy pipeline tripped the Fernwick vault's lockout threshold. The dataloader change itself is reviewed and safe. To let the rollout proceed, the vault must be reopened with the recovery passphrase shown below.

strongbox words: prawyn-fenmir